Fleet Services is currently hiring a Sr. Mobile Diesel Technician.
The Sr. Mobile Diesel Technician will be responsible for performing licensed DOT inspections, Preventative Maintenance inspections, light and advanced repairs, advanced mechanical/hydraulic/electrical and electronic diagnostics, and other duties as assigned. Heavily relied upon for advanced diagnostics and triage of complicated repairs by Mobile Diesel Technician I/II. Considered the Lead on jobsites by customers and Technicians. Functions as a consultant on the customer's behalf. A successful Sr Mobile Diesel Technician complies with all company policies and achieves high level performance metrics.
DUTIES:
- Perform scheduled preventative maintenance (“PM”), DOT Inspections, and follow-up repairs on light, medium, and heavy-duty vehicles in a mobile/field environment.
- Perform minor adjustments and repairs on various types of truck equipment including, but not limited to: Electrical/Brake/Cooling Systems, Starters/Alternators, Fan clutches, Engine electronics, Diesel steering systems, Engines (gas and diesel), Transmissions (manual and automatic), Clutches, Differentials, etc.
- Diagnose, adjust, and repair various types of truck equipment, including the above.
- Inspect, test, and listen to defective equipment to diagnose malfunctions, using test instruments such as handheld computers and pressure gauges.
- Road test vehicles to diagnose malfunctions and to ensure proper operation.
- Identify problems, determine the accuracy and relevance of information, using sound judgment to generate and evaluate alternatives.
- Manage parts inventory and equipment on the company-issued service truck, performing periodic reconciliation.
- Maintain and operate company-issued service vehicle, conduct safety checks, and pre-/post-trip inspections.
- Work with clients and customers to assess needs, provide information or assistance, resolve problems, or satisfy expectations.
- Manage concurrent tasks, prioritize work activities and time effectively.
- Use hand tools, precision instruments, Diesel tools, welding equipment, lifts, and jacks.
- Document work according to company standards and upload pictures of work performed, parts used, and findings on Repair Orders (“RO”) using company-issued iOS device and proprietary TRAIT application.
- Complete DOT forms and other documentation timely.
- Work independently, managing your daily schedule.
- Maintain high productivity and work within or close to Standard Repair Times.
- Obtain parts from approved vendors as necessary.
- Communicate with management/support team via email or phone for approvals, purchase orders, or discussing RO notes.
- Perform all work adhering to safety, health, environmental policies, and federal regulations, including OSHA, EPA, and DOT.
- Conduct safety checks and daily pre/post trip inspections of the service truck.
REQUIREMENTS:
- High School Diploma/GED and 5 years’ experience in a related field, or alternative combinations such as higher education with 3 years’ experience, or 7 years’ experience.
- Possess and supply a set of hand tools necessary for the job.
- Obtain ASE T8 (PMI) certification within 18 months.
- Obtain 608/609 certification within 18 months.
- Must pass a DOT-regulated pre-employment background screening and physical.
- Valid DOT medical card with more than 4 months remaining may suffice temporarily.
- Must be at least 21 years old due to interstate commerce regulations.
- Valid driver’s license, able to obtain and maintain DQF, and eligible to drive per DOT requirements.
